Uwi And Usm Sign Mou Marking Historic Solidarity In The Caribbean

Antonio Carmona Baez, President of USMand Sir Henry Beckles, Vice-Chancellor UWI.

POND ISLAND-- University of St. Martin (USM) and University of the West Indies (UWI) have sign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) marking a historic partnership between the two universities.

USM after a decade of working in close partnership with UWI Open Campus, expressed an interest in joining UWI global system which includes joint centres with ten international universities, USM announced in a press release on Saturday.

The UWI Council discussed the concept note and approved it in principle earlier this year, asking Vice-Chancellor, Professor Sir Hilary Beckles and his team to develop a road map with a full proposal for further consideration.

That process began with the signing of an MOU between the two universities on Wednesday, October 7.

Vice-Chancellor of UWI, Professor Sir Beckles and Valerie Giterson-Pantophlet, President of the Board of USM met virtually to sign the MOU which marked a historic partnership, not only between the universities, but significantly for the framework for collaboration and regional development now established between the Dutch Caribbean and English-speaking territories of UWI.

Twelve colourful murals now brighten up Philipsburg. In photo: Youngest artist Annabelle Verheij (16) with her mural SXM Strong. (John van Kerkhof photo)

PHILIPSBURG--Be The Change Foundation proudly presented a sneak peek into its @colormesxm mural project to participating artists, partners and sponsors. In recent weeks, the twelve participating artists and their volunteers put in lots of hard work to help bring colour and art to Philipsburg, and their results were unofficially unveiled on Friday afternoon.

Present for the official kick-off of the mural project were Minister of Education, Culture, Youth and Sport (ECYS) Rodolphe Samuel and Minister of Tourism, Economic Affairs, Transport and Telecommunication (TEATT) Ludmilla de Weever.
